Pumpkin and Sweet Potato Soup

A delightful soup perfect for autumn, combining the sweetness of pumpkin and sweet potato.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 medium pumpkin
  • 2 medium sweet potatoes
  • 1 large onion
  • 4 cups vegetable broth
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 2 teaspoons ground cinnamon
  • 1 teaspoon nutmeg
  • salt to taste
  • p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. Peel and cube the pumpkin and sweet potatoes.
  2. In a large pot, heat olive oil over medium heat and sauté the onions until translucent.
  3. Add the pumpkin and sweet potatoes, followed by vegetable broth. Bring to a boil.
  4. Reduce heat and let simmer for about 30 minutes until the vegetables are tender.
  5. Blend the soup until smooth, then season with cinnamon, nutmeg, salt, and pepper.
  6. Serve hot, garnished with a sprinkle of cinnamon if desired.

Notes

  • This soup can be made ahead of time and stored in the refrigerator.
  • For added creaminess, stir in some coconut milk or heavy cream before serving.
